Add 63/50 and 27/8
1st number: 1 13/50, 2nd number: 3 3/8
63/50 + 27/8 is 927/200.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 50 and 8 is 200
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 200 - For the 1st fraction, since 50 × 4 = 200,
63/50 = 63 × 4/50 × 4 = 252/200 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 8 × 25 = 200,
27/8 = 27 × 25/8 × 25 = 675/200 - Add the two like fractions:
252/200 + 675/200 = 252 + 675/200 = 927/200 - So, 63/50 + 27/8 = 927/200
In mixed form: 4127/200
